Summary

Version bump 0.5.0 → 0.6.0. First release shipping the quality gate: prview gate subcommand with the 0/1/2/3 exit-code contract, the composite GitHub Action, the measured pre-push profile, plus the full 2026-07-07 polish round (signal-truth #14 + contract-packaging #15 — all 15 confirmed audit findings and 14 review threads).

This closes the gap where v0.5.0 predates the gate entirely: after tagging v0.6.0, external consumers get a working gate from a released artifact for the first time.

  • CHANGELOG.md generated from conventional commits since v0.5.0
  • make release-gate: 12 pass / 0 fail / 1 warn (tag not created yet — expected pre-merge)

After merge (operator flow)

make release-tagmake release-push (tag triggers release.yml: builds + GitHub Release + OIDC publish to crates.io).
